InvenTrust Properties acquires N. Carolina retail center
Business Wire
OAK BROOK - InvenTrust Properties Corp. recently acquired Renaissance Center, a 96-percent leased, 363,176 square foot retail power center in Durham, North Carolina, for $129.2 million.
Renaissance Center includes a broad mix of national and local destination retailers, service tenants, restaurants and office space, which promotes continual traffic along a dominant retail corridor. Other anchors include Old Navy, Cost Plus World Market, REI, Babies "R" Us and Best Buy.
"This acquisition underscores our strategy of owning a strong asset from which we can significantly bolster our presence in key regions with favorable demographics," said Michael E. Podboy, executive vice president - chief financial officer, chief investment officer of InvenTrust. "We are excited by the opportunity that Renaissance Center creates for InvenTrust in North Carolina and the Raleigh-Durham MSA,"
Christopher Covey, senior vice president of transactions, added the proximity to Research Triangle Park allows Renaissance Center to benefit from favorable population demographics in Raleigh, Durham and Chapel Hill.
"Renaissance Center also boasts a strong tenant base, including the only Nordstrom Rack in the market, and is located near the high trafficked Streets of Southport Mall, one of the top performing retail malls in the region," Covey said.
